    One thing I did observe is that both Dick and Babs have the same view of relationships. I mean Dick has quite a few love interests but he had intentions to pursue something deeper, and with Babs she doesn't waste her time with relationships that don't go anywhere. Which is why Burnside annoyed me. I don't mind the amount of love interests to a degree, but it was the lack of quality of love interests. I can't recall anyone's name except Luke and that's because he's previously established as his own character. If I can't remember their names then I don't think the writers served Barbara's story. I'm a big fan of comicbook romance, which is why I've been attached to the more stable relationships of Arthur and Mera and more recently Dinah and Ollie in Percy's run, so to see that trope in my favorite genre being underdeveloped is a bit deflating.

    Also I don't mind Babs drinking or just being a bit more carefree in general, but I need to recognize her when they do so. I don't what to retrain my perspective of character to suit dull writing.

    Anyways, Scott is off to a good start. I look forward to more Jim and more family drama. I'm also interested to see the new costume in action.
